Output 3a89f9a8587723e48e73bcb8259b20dc9c4e0ef291db136c00a82777f6b2a3ec:2

value
7720788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dda272d9862abcd7af752dd54f6c28f0d197f48a OP_EQUAL
address
3Mtus4qusndSUBSv5W9vU89MWB3j1fpjov
transaction
3a89f9a8587723e48e73bcb8259b20dc9c4e0ef291db136c00a82777f6b2a3ec
confirmations
231129
spent
true